Tony Morris is an Assistant Professor of English at Armstrong-Atlantic State University, in Savannah, GA. His first book of poems, Fugue's End won the 2004 North Carolina Writer's Network Mary Belle Campbell Poetry Book Publication Award. His second book, Back to Cain, is due out in May, 2005.
